While waiting at a red light on Highway 20, through Bao Loc City, a 60-year-old man riding a motorbike was run over by a "driverless" truck and died on the spot.
On May 18, according to information from the Lam Dong Provincial Police Department, the unit detained driver Phan Van Cong (38 years old, from Nam Dinh) to serve the investigation.
Driver Cong was the one who "abandoned" the truck on the side of the road, letting the "driverless" vehicle run over and kill a man on Tran Phu Street (National Highway 20), B'Lao Ward (Bao Loc City) at the traffic light intersection (Ly Tu Trong intersection and National Highway 20) on the afternoon of May 17.
